‘Stoned’ cyclist killer released after paying bail

Bohnen death bail

THE driver who ran over and killed German cyclist Christoph Bohnen has been
been released from jail after paying
€10,000 bail.

Anais Marco Batalla, 28, claims she was dazzled by the sun when driving on the MA-15 and did not see the group of cyclists when she crashed into them.

Batalla failed a roadside drug test after the incident and admitted smoking a large quantity of cannabis on the night before the accident.

As part of the bail terms Batalla must give up her passport, agree not to leave the island and report to the court on the 1st and 15th of each month.
